FinalApproachSegmentDataBlock
urn:aero:airm:1.0.0:LogicalModel:Subjects:AirspaceInfrastructure:RouteAndProcedure:FinalApproachSegmentDataBlock
The additional information about the Precision Final Segment. Most attributes describe the LPV path point record required for WAAS procedures.
Properties | Definition | Type |
---|---|---|
approachPerformanceDesignator | Approach Performance Designator. A number from 0 to 7 that identifies the type of approach. |
Integer |
verticalAlarmLimit | Half the length of a segment on the vertical axis (perpendicular to the horizontal plane of WGS-84 ellipsoid), with its centre being at the true position, which describes the region which is required to contain the indicated vertical position with a probability of 1-E-7 per approach, assuming the probability of a GPS satellite integrity failure being included in the position solution is less than or equal to E-4 per hour. |
Decimal |
thresholdCourseWidth | The width of the lateral course at the Landing Threshold Point (LTP). This width, in conjunction with the location of the Flight Path Alignment Point (FPAP) defines the sensitivity of the lateral deviations throughout the approach. | ValDistanceType |
satelliteBasedAugmentationSystemServiceProvider | SBAS Service Provider Identifier. A number from 0 to 15 that associates the approach procedure to a particular satellite based approach system service provider. |
Integer |
routeIndicator | Route Indicator. A single alpha character (A through Z or blank, omitting I and O) used to differentiate between multiple final approach segments to the same runway or heliport. |
CharacterString |
remainderCyclicRedundancyCheck | Hexadecimal representation of the 32-bit CRC used to check the integrity of the FAS data block. | ValHexType |
referencePathIdentifier | Reference Path Identifier. A four-character identifier that is used to confirm selection of the correct approach procedure. |
CharacterString |
referencePathDataSelector | Reference Path Data Selector (RPDS). A number (0-48) that enables automatic tuning of a procedure by LAAS avionics. |
Integer |
operationType | Operation Type. A number from 0 to 15 that indicates the type of the final approach segment. |
Integer |
lengthOffset | Distance from the stop end of the runway to the Flight Path Alignment Point | ValDistanceType |
horizontalAlarmLimit | The radius of a circle in the horizontal plane (the local plane tangent to the WGS-84 ellipsoid), with its centre being at the true position, which describes the region which is required to contain the indicated horizontal position with the required probability for a particular navigation mode assuming the probability of a GPS satellite integrity failure being included in the position solution is less than or equal to E-4 per hour. |
Decimal |
codeICAO | The first two designators of the ICAO location identifier, as identified in ICAO Doc 7910. |
CharacterString |
